addon to browse DeviantWatch lists

Journal Entry: Fri Nov 23, 2007, 10:00 AM
type: browser addon (I tested it on firefox, but it works on others)

Yesterday I was browsing DeviantArt and went to the "deviantwatch" section. I don't visit the site often so I had like 40 new deviations to check. Right after I saw that huge list I thought "a text list? I would like to see the thumbnails like in the front page" but for deviantwatch, that's a paid feature.
Browsing for a firefox extension that could help me I found this "Cooliris Preview" addon. It's not exactly what I was looking for, but it did the trick. I browsed that huge list in a smooth way.
Basically it displays a floating box inside the tab you're on, showing the link you're hovering onto with the mouse. Once you've seen the pic, you can hover your mouse on the next item and it will automatically display it on the already opened box. You can also browse the displayed page inside the box as if it was a firefox tab. You can change the way it opens the links trough its options.

So give it a try if you have huge lists of links that you want to peek or browse without overpopulating your tab bar (I get lost in those, haha).
